Welcome to FillRoute! As release manager you'll cut weekly builds of the restock planner and push them to the Brimley staging fleet. Before your first deploy, run the smoke suite against the planner's internal inventory service — it won't pass without credentials. For staging, authenticate with the key below.

gateway credential: kto3_qfe

Drift detected on the Quillgate audit-log viewer. Prod is paginating at 200 rows while the repo says 50; retention filter is also disabled in prod, contrary to the committed config. Likely a hotfix from the Marbrook incident that never landed in the repo. This PR reconciles the repo to match prod intent, then we re-deploy from source. Please review the diff against what prod is actually serving. For comparison, the live values pulled from prod this morning are shown below.

settings of bahop-kaweg:
[novael]
host = novael.braskstack.example
user = novael_svc
database = novael_prod

- [ ] **Step 7: Breaker override escrow.** After sealing the signing keys for the Tallgrove upstream API circuit breaker, confirm the support team can force the breaker open during a full outage. The override bundle lives in the sealed escrow drawer and is useless without its unlock phrase. Two ceremony witnesses must initial this step before proceeding. The escrow bundle is decrypted with the recovery passphrase that follows.

vault phrase of kahip-kahop = holath-quenmir

Re: the Harrowby ORM refactor — don't touch the lazy-load paths yet. Swap the session factory first, keep the old mappers behind the shim, and delete nothing until the Dunmere tests pass. Batch sizes and cache TTLs here are deliberate; they were tuned against production traces, not guesses. Current values for reference follow.

tuning table, yajog-yahof:
BUDGETS = {
    "lamvan": 303,
    "wenox": 460,
    "fenvan": 525,
}

Handover — Lab 4B, Vantrel Building. Contractors from Morrow Fitouts arrive Tuesday. The lab is shared with the Calyx team; do not move their bench kit or the fume rig by the east wall. Keep the connecting door to 4C shut. Waste bins get collected Thursday only. If contractors need solo access before I'm back, Deya has agreed they can use the shared-lab pass below.

turnstile pass: bdg-FVNQRS-72965873